As technology continues to evolve, so do the challenges associated with IT security. This article delves into the top IT security trends that businesses should watch for in 2023.
Ransomware attacks have surged in recent years, and 2023 is expected to see this trend continue. Organizations must invest in robust security measures to protect against these devastating attacks.
The Zero Trust model, which requires verification for every user and device attempting to access resources, is gaining traction. This approach minimizes risks associated with unauthorized access and data breaches.
As data privacy concerns grow, regulatory frameworks are becoming more stringent. Businesses will need to stay compliant with regulations such as GDPR and CCPA to avoid hefty fines.
Artificial intelligence is increasingly being used in cybersecurity to enhance threat detection and response capabilities. AI-driven solutions can analyze vast amounts of data to identify anomalies and potential threats.
Human error remains a significant factor in security breaches. Organizations must prioritize security training for employees, ensuring they are equipped to recognize and respond to potential threats.
In 2023, businesses must remain proactive in addressing IT security challenges. By staying informed of the latest trends and implementing effective strategies, organizations can enhance their resilience against cyber threats.
